Dos of Typography



To boost the readability and visual allure of your web site, guarantee that you pick font styles that are very easy to review and suitably sized. Pick font styles that are clear and legible, such as sans-serif or serif typefaces, which are generally utilized for body text. https://www.forbes.com/sites/theyec/2022/04/29/how-female-business-leaders-and-entrepreneurs-can-compete-in-the-digital-marketing-world/ -serif typefaces like Arial or Helvetica function well for digital screens, offering a modern and clean look. On the other hand, serif font styles like Times New Roman or Georgia can add a touch of sophistication and custom to your web site.

Another essential aspect to think about is font sizing. See to it your text is huge enough to be read pleasantly without straining the eyes. Select a typeface dimension of at least 16px for body text to make certain readability. Additionally, utilize various font style sizes to develop a visual hierarchy on your site. Headings and subheadings ought to be bigger and bolder than the body text, leading the reader with the content effortlessly.

Donts of Typography



Stay away from using an extreme range of fonts in your web design to keep uniformity and readability for your audience. When it involves typography, much less is typically more.



Here are some essential 'Do n'ts' to keep in mind:

1. ** Stay clear of making use of too many different typefaces **: Limit yourself to 2-3 fonts for your whole site. Utilizing a lot more can make your design appearance messy and unprofessional.

2. ** Do not utilize font styles that are difficult to read **: Fancy or excessively ornamental fonts may look attractive, however if they sacrifice readability, they aren't worth it. Stick to font styles that are easy on the eyes.

3. ** Avoid utilizing tiny typeface dimensions **: Little message may appear streamlined, but if it's as well tiny, it can strain your visitors' eyes. Make certain your text is big sufficient to review conveniently on all devices.
